While the United Nations welcomed the move, reports of continued Israeli strikes in Lebanon underscored the fragility of the ceasefire. Diplomats involved in the negotiations, including Pakistan, framed the agreement as a temporary reprieve rather than a lasting solution.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Both sides claimed victory in the ceasefire deal, reflecting the deep mistrust that remains. U.S. officials emphasized the need to reopen strategic waterways to stabilize global markets, while Iranian leaders portrayed the truce as proof of resilience against Western pressure. Analysts warn that unless concrete steps toward peace are taken, the ceasefire risks becoming another short-lived pause in a cycle of conflict.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Public reaction across the region has been mixed. In Tehran, crowds gathered to celebrate what they saw as a symbolic win, while in Beirut, displaced families expressed frustration that bombings continued despite the ceasefire announcement. On social media, international audiences voiced skepticism, with many noting that temporary truces often fail to address the root causes of instability.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Global powers, including the European Union and the United Nations, urged all parties to use the ceasefire as a foundation for broader negotiations. Lawmakers in Washington and European capitals echoed calls for restraint, stressing that the humanitarian toll must be prioritized. Yet, the persistence of strikes and retaliations highlights how fragile the situation remains, even with diplomatic pressure.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>For international audiences, the ceasefire illustrates both the urgency and difficulty of reshaping the Middle East\u2019s political landscape. Whether or not the truce holds, the region continues to undergo shifts in alliances, power balances, and public sentiment. The coming weeks will determine if this pause leads to meaningful progress or simply sets the stage for renewed confrontation.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>The recent U.S.-Iran ceasefire has offered a brief pause in weeks of escalating violence across the Middle East, but ongoing strikes in Lebanon and regional tensions show that the reshuffling of alliances and power is far from over.
